Output f07f8c66e1a42ce655404be164dff3dc0ee50f6e281a5b3351295528205f84d7:3

value
4377218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37403e6918af71d56553714578568369ca184 OP_EQUAL
address
3BMEX7KUHbiFBsmHhjWniGKjY6hjaDptPz
transaction
f07f8c66e1a42ce655404be164dff3dc0ee50f6e281a5b3351295528205f84d7